Abstract The effects of magnesium on the influx, net entry, and efflux of amino acids by larvae of the sea urchin Strongylocentrotus purpuratus were investigated. Kinetic studies revealed that the influx of alanine is not dependent on external magnesium. In addition, influx and net entry are equivalent, as determined by high performance liquid chromatography (HPLC), and are independent of ambient magnesium concentrations.
